我有2张图片在彼此之上.
没有< br />在两者之间,顶部图像的底部边界接触底部图像的顶部边界,这似乎是它应该是的.
然后如果我放1< br />,则在2个图像之间应该有一些空间.如果我把2< br />,应该有更多的空间.
这是问题所在
firefox 3.5版似乎忽略了第一个< br />.如果我放2,那么它会在2幅图像之间留出一些空间.
ie7在两个图像之间留出一些空间,即使我没有放任何< br />
在Chrome或Safari中工作正常,即没有没有< br />的空间,有1< br />的空间,2的更多空间等等…
我还没有在ie8中测试过.
有没有办法解决浏览器似乎没有解释< br />的事实?用同样的方式标记?
感谢您的见解!
解决方法 尝试使用CSS定位图像而不是依赖于br标记.img { display: block; margin: 0 0 20px 0; }
例如.
总结以上是内存溢出为你收集整理的HTML标记不兼容跨浏览器全部内容,希望文章能够帮你解决HTML标记不兼容跨浏览器所遇到的程序开发问题。
如果觉得内存溢出网站内容还不错,欢迎将内存溢出网站推荐给程序员好友。
欢迎分享,转载请注明来源:内存溢出
评论列表(0条)